Key Specifications
When evaluating lithium-ion batteries for vaping, several key specifications should be considered:
- Capacity (mAh): The capacity of a battery, measured in milliamp hours (mAh), indicates how much energy it can store. For vaping, higher capacity batteries typically provide longer usage time between charges. Vapers should choose batteries with a capacity that aligns with their usage patterns to avoid frequent recharging.
- Discharge Rate (C Rating): The discharge rate is crucial as it determines how quickly a battery can release its stored energy. For sub-ohm vaping, where higher wattages are typically used, a battery with a higher discharge rate (measured in C ratings) is essential to prevent overheating and ensure safety.
- Voltage: Lithium-ion batteries typically have a nominal voltage of 3.7 volts. However, the voltage can vary based on the charge level. It’s important for users to match their devices with appropriate voltage specifications to optimize performance and prevent damage.
- Size and Form Factor: The physical size and shape of the battery must match the vaping device. Common formats include 18650, 21700, and 20700 batteries. Users should ensure compatibility to maintain device integrity and performance.
Safety Considerations
With power comes responsibility. Vaping enthusiasts should prioritize safety when selecting lithium-ion batteries. Look for batteries with built-in safety features, such as overcharge protection and short circuit prevention. It’s also advisable to use batteries from reputable manufacturers and avoid counterfeit products.
